.TH "sc::BEMSolvent" 3 "Sun Oct 4 2020" "Version 2.3.1" "MPQC" \" -*- nroff -*- .ad l .nh .SH NAME sc::BEMSolvent .SH SYNOPSIS .br .PP .PP Inherits \fBsc::DescribedClass\fP\&. .SS "Public Member Functions" .in +1c .ti -1c .RI "\fBBEMSolvent\fP (const \fBRef\fP< \fBKeyVal\fP > &)" .br .ti -1c .RI "void \fBinit\fP ()" .br .ti -1c .RI "void \fBdone\fP (int clear_surface=1)" .br .ti -1c .RI "int \fBncharge\fP ()" .br .ti -1c .RI "\fBRef\fP< \fBMolecule\fP > \fBsolvent\fP ()" .br .ti -1c .RI "double \fBsolvent_density\fP ()" .br .ti -1c .RI "double ** \fBalloc_charge_positions\fP ()" .br .ti -1c .RI "void \fBfree_charge_positions\fP (double **a)" .br .ti -1c .RI "double ** \fBalloc_normals\fP ()" .br .ti -1c .RI "void \fBfree_normals\fP (double **a)" .br .ti -1c .RI "double * \fBalloc_efield_dot_normals\fP ()" .br .ti -1c .RI "void \fBfree_efield_dot_normals\fP (double *a)" .br .ti -1c .RI "double * \fBalloc_charges\fP ()" .br .ti -1c .RI "void \fBfree_charges\fP (double *a)" .br .ti -1c .RI "void \fBcharge_positions\fP (double **)" .br .ti -1c .RI "void \fBnormals\fP (double **)" .br .ti -1c .RI "void \fBcompute_charges\fP (double *efield_dot_normals, double *charge)" .br .ti -1c .RI "void \fBnormalize_charge\fP (double enclosed_charge, double *charges)" .br .ti -1c .RI "double \fBnuclear_charge_interaction_energy\fP (double *nuclear_charge, double **charge_positions, double *charge)" .br .ti -1c .RI "double \fBnuclear_interaction_energy\fP (double **charge_positions, double *charge)" .br .ti -1c .RI "double \fBself_interaction_energy\fP (double **charge_positions, double *charge)" .br .ti -1c .RI "double \fBpolarization_charge\fP (double *charge)" .br .ti -1c .RI "double \fBarea\fP () const" .br .ti -1c .RI "double \fBvolume\fP () const" .br .ti -1c .RI "double \fBcomputed_enclosed_charge\fP () const" .br .ti -1c .RI "double \fBdisp\fP ()" .br .ti -1c .RI "double \fBrep\fP ()" .br .ti -1c .RI "double \fBdisprep\fP ()" .br .ti -1c .RI "void \fBinit_system_matrix\fP ()" .br .ti -1c .RI "\fBRef\fP< \fBTriangulatedImplicitSurface\fP > \fBsurface\fP () const" .br .ti -1c .RI "\fBRef\fP< \fBSCMatrixKit\fP > \fBmatrixkit\fP ()" .br .in -1c .SS "Additional Inherited Members" .SH "Author" .PP Generated automatically by Doxygen for MPQC from the source code\&.